There are many different benefits of hiring a therapy dog near you in Edison, NJ. To start, therapy dogs can provide comfort and support to people who are dealing with emotional challenges such as anxiety, depression, and stress. They can also help to reduce feelings of loneliness and isolation. Therapy dogs have also been shown to have a positive effect on physical healing. They can help to lower blood pressure and reduce pain.
When you hire therapy dog near you in Edison, NJ, they will have received extensive training, including basic obedience training, socialization, task-specific training, and certification. If you have specific requirements for therapy dogs, be sure to speak with their handler about your needs.
When you go to buy a therapy dog near you in Edison, NJ, you should interview a few different therapy dog providers to learn more about the specific training each therapy dog has. Some may focus on mental health issues, whereas others may be able to provide more physical support.
